In this first lecture, Rev. Macleod introduces us to what theologians call “the Order of Salvation.” God is systematic in all that he does. He is the God of order, and not confusion. The universe he created is an amazingly-ordered universe, which makes science and mathematics possible. Things do not happen randomly or by chance. The universe has laws, and scientific investigation is thinking God’s thoughts after him. Come along as we discover the inner workings of God’s order for the salvation of fallen mankind.
